The Irish government recently updated its Critical Skills Occupations List and increased quotas for certain professions.
Key Points:
Additional Information: Current processing times for employment permits can be found here. Ireland reviews and updates the critical skills lists twice a year. Changes to the lists were made based on labor market conditions, submissions from relevant stakeholders and the currently COVID-19 situation.
BAL Analysis: The decision to add occupations to the Critical Skills List and increase quotas for some professions is intended to make it easier for companies to hire more foreign workers and alleviate labor shortages across the country.
